Condition
The canvas has been relined. The paint surface is largely stable and the cracquelure is secured by a thick varnish which is a little yellowed. There are appear to be some retouchings, particularly to the sky, although the varnish renders thorough examination under UV light impossible. The signature J Vernet, lower right, clearly fluoresces under UV light as a later addition. Offered in an elaborate carved and gilt wood frame.

Catalogue Note
A 19th century copy after the original in Florence, Galleria Corsini (see Luigi Salerno, Salvator Rosa, Milan, 1975, p. 89, cat. no. 64).
